turbo is a very helpful IDE for learning c/C++ language. it works on windows. following steps below you can make it work on ubuntu-----

open terminal and write-

sudo apt-get install dosbox

open the dosbox(applications-> games-> dosbox)

write-

mount c ~/

this will make your home folder as c drive. now move to the c drive(actually home folder). write-

c:

now copy and paste the TC folder in your home folder

in dosbox write these commands-

cd tc/bin

tc
................................................................

now it is coding time.......

there are some problems. but you can solve it. the up, down, right, left key wont work. you can use right side 2(down),4(left),6(right),8(up) to solve the problem. if it does not work press the num lock for 3 or 4 times and leave it on.

Hmm... one slight problem.
Once I clicked inside dosbox, I failed to switch windows using alt-tab, or move the mouse pointer outside dosbox. I had to exit from dosbox to get control over the other windows.
Any idea how to switch windows after you click inside dosbox?

And everytime I executed Dosbox, I had to mount C, and etc.
Anyway to set the home/ as the default root directory Muctadir?



Edit: Hell this is difficult to manage..using G++ and GCC is a far better choice to me buddy.
TC is good, but using it via DosBox makes it veerrrrryyyy difficult.

TC provides you a very rich help archive. if you are using linux and want to see the help, you have to reboot in windows or use virtual machine. and now about the problem. i had the same problem too and forgot to mention that. you can press alt+enter to maximize the dosbox and again press alt+enter to minimize the window. after you minimize this way you get the control over window. again, i posted this topic that does not mean that everyone have to use it. you may not use it if you don't like it.
